Interventions
DEVICE

3D-models

"The study radiologist will generate a patient-specific virtual 3D model of the participant's body from their pre-operational medical scans (CT, and MRI if available) using regulated commercial medical image analysis software, specifically Osirix MD 9.0 (Pixmeo, Geneva, Switzerland).(Rosset et al. 2004)~The CRFw checks that the medical scan segmentation is accurate and validates the virtual 3D model.~The surgeon checks that the medical scan segmentation is accurate and validates the virtual 3D model.~The surgeon uses all available medical scan data, and the virtual 3D model as an adjunct, to assess the patient anatomy and plan the operation accordingly"
